Output 39f94187fadb988bc809538323f6ac86d28540589393db49262ca1efa208242c:1

value
2633149
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e9a7c9da10ef6770f7f9239b2561e97d6d49a27 OP_EQUAL
address
3BmqKaHmwSWY4aj68n7Bt1kEktCiEHHQMZ
transaction
39f94187fadb988bc809538323f6ac86d28540589393db49262ca1efa208242c
spent
true